H₂O₂ → H₂O + O₂

The above equation can be balance as illustrated below:

H₂O₂ → H₂O + O₂

There are 2 atoms of O on the left side and a total of 3 atoms on the right side. It can be balance by putting 2 in front of H₂O₂ and 2 in front of H₂O as shown below:

2H₂O₂ → 2H₂O + O₂

Now, the equation is balanced.

**** check ****

Element >>> Left Side >>> Right Side

H >>>>>>>>> 4 >>>>>>>>> 4

O >>>>>>>>> 4 >>>>>>>>> 4
